Understanding Billboard Advertising Contracts

A billboard advertising contract is a formal agreement that outlines the terms and conditions under which an advertisement will be displayed on a billboard. The contract should cover all the critical aspects of the advertising arrangement, including the location of the billboard, the duration of the ad campaign, and the size and specifications of the advertisement.

One of the first steps in creating a billboard advertising contract is determining the location of the billboard. The site of the billboard has a direct impact on the advertisement’s visibility and, consequently, its potential success. High-traffic areas are typically more desirable, but they also come with a higher price tag. It’s important to balance the cost with the expected return on investment.

The duration of the advertisement is another vital component of the contract. Advertisers may opt for short-term contracts for seasonal campaigns or longer agreements for ongoing brand awareness. The contract should specify the start and end dates of the advertisement, as well as any provisions for renewing the contract.

Advertisement specifications, such as the size, design, and materials used for the billboard, should also be clearly defined in the contract. These details ensure that the advertisement is produced and displayed according to the agreed standards. Additionally, the contract should address the maintenance and repair of the billboard, particularly in the event of damage due to weather or other unforeseen circumstances.

Key Elements of a Billboard Contract

The contract should include detailed information about the payment terms. This includes the total cost of the advertising campaign, payment schedule, and any deposits or fees required upfront. It’s also important to outline the consequences of late payments or non-payment, to protect the financial interests of the billboard owner.

Another crucial element of the contract is the content clause. This section should detail the advertiser’s responsibilities regarding the content of the advertisement. It should comply with all local laws and regulations, and not contain any offensive or prohibited material. The billboard owner typically reserves the right to approve or reject the ad content before it goes live.

Liability and indemnification clauses are also essential in a billboard advertising contract. These sections protect both parties from legal disputes arising from the advertisement’s content or any accidents related to the billboard’s structure. It’s important to clearly state who is responsible for what and under which circumstances.

Finally, the contract should include a termination clause. This outlines the conditions under which either party can terminate the agreement and the notice period required. It should also specify any penalties or refunds due in the event of early termination.

Best Practices for Billboard Advertising Agreements

When drafting a billboard advertising contract, it’s important to follow best practices to ensure a fair and legally binding agreement. This includes using clear and concise language, avoiding legal jargon that may confuse non-lawyers, and ensuring that all parties fully understand the terms and conditions before signing.

Both parties should review the contract thoroughly and negotiate any terms that are not mutually agreeable. It’s often beneficial to have a lawyer review the contract to ensure that it complies with all applicable laws and regulations.

It’s also advisable to include a clause that allows for amendments to the contract. This provides flexibility to both parties to make changes to the agreement as needed, provided that both parties agree to the amendments in writing.

Lastly, maintaining a professional relationship and open communication between the advertiser and the billboard owner is key to a successful partnership. This helps to resolve any issues quickly and amicably, and ensures that the advertising campaign runs smoothly.
